Weighted Values for Direct and Maternal Genetic Effects to Maximize the Accuracy of Index Selection
A method was devised to obtain weighted values for the additive direct and maternal genetic effects of a single trait, estimated using a selection index to maximize the accuracy of selection. A method maximizing the square of the selection accuracy was used. This method should facilitate optimal genetic evaluation when the economic weights of direct and maternal genetic effects are unknown or difficult to establish.

Animal Science Journal (a continuation of Animal Science and Technology) is the official journal of the Japanese Society of Animal Science (JSAS) and publishes Original Research Articles (full papers and rapid communications) in English in all fields of animal and poultry science: genetics and breeding, genetic engineering, reproduction, embryo manipulation, nutrition, feeds and feeding, physiology, anatomy, environment and behavior, animal products (milk, meat, eggs and their by-products) and their processing, and livestock economics. Animal Science Journal will invite Review Articles in consultations with Editors. Submission to the Journal is open to those who are interested in animal science.
